On March 1st, Professor Oreste Pollicino will hold the kick-off lecture of the Jean Monnet Module “Digital Citizenship for EU”, offered by the Dipartimento di Scienze Politiche of the Università degli Studi di Roma Tre and aimed at providing students with an in-depth knowledge about the main legal and political aspects – at International and European level – concerning the citizens’ online life, focusing in particular on digital rights.
Professor Pollicino will focus on the issue “Digital constitutionalism from a transatlantic perspective. Reframing European citizenship in the algorithmic society”.
